It was a bold move, sending American Football to these shores, but the organisers knew they needed to do something bold. Around 20 years ago, they were concerned that they had exhausted all of their revenue streams. They couldn’t extend the NFL season because the players needed a long recovery time, so creating new teams wasn’t really an option. Thus, they decided to take the NFL on tour.

In 2005, they decided to play a regular season NFL match outside of the US for the first time, when the Arizona Cardinals met the San Francisco 49ers in Mexico City. When they sold over 100,000 tickets, they knew they were on to something, and so the NFL International Series was created to take the game even further afield.

Fast forward to 2007 and Wembley Stadium hosted an NFL game for the first time, when the New York Giants faced the Miami Dolphins – for that fixture 40,000 tickets were sold in the first hour and a half after going on sale. The number of games in London, and the popularity of the sport has grown and grown from there. Twickenham and the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ium have also hosted fixtures, while the Jacksonville Jaguars have started to make an annual appearance in London.

Saint Mark’s Square

A little slice of Venice in Vegas – this is a great area to spend an afternoon. There are plenty of shops, bars and restaurants to enjoy, but the real appeal is on the streets themselves. Sketch artists, jugglers, singers and entertainers all line the streets to give you something to smile about.

The High Roller

Take in the view from the world’s second tallest Ferris wheel. Try to time it during the practice session and you could watch the cars whizzing around the track from the best seats in the city! If you haven’t got the stomach for a Ferris wheel, try one of the many rooftop bars in the city – views unlike anywhere else in the world.

The Grand Canyon

Speaking of spectacular views, how about a helicopter ride to see the Grand Canyon up close? This is the sort of once-in-a-lifetime experience that you should make the effort to do while you’re in Las Vegas – it’s a stunning trip that will leave you speechless.

ATV Dune Tour

How about channelling your own Lewis Hamilton while exploring the Las Vegas Dunes?! Take an incredible tour of the desert on zippy little quad bikes.
